How does Instant Pot control the pressure during the cooking phase without leaking steam?

Instant Pot is equipped with a pressure sensor under the heating element. When the working pressure is reached, heating stops. When the pressure is lower than desired working pressure, heating restarts. This maintains pressure at a certain range, see attached diagram. This pressure is not strong enough to lift the steam release. Therefore, there is no steam coming out during cooking.
